Subject: Weather-alert fan-out rollout

Hey plugin folks — heads up that Stormkite's alert fan-out now batches deliveries every 15 seconds instead of firing per-alert. If your plugin assumed one payload per event, update your handler to iterate the alerts array. Old behavior goes away in two weeks. To test against the new build, reference the token below.

build token for tagag-bagug: htk9_cbc9baf18

== Environment Variables: Relevance Tuning (Project Quillsort) ==

Quick notes for whoever inherits this. The ranking experiments read their weights from env vars, not the config service — yes, we know, it's on the backlog. QUILLSORT_BOOST_TITLE and QUILLSORT_DECAY_DAYS are safe to tweak in staging. The experiment dashboard needs authenticated access to pull click logs from the Murmuration pipeline, though. Before running any tuning job, make sure your .env contains this line:

env line for yajep-bajof: ARCHIVE_KEY3=015

TURN-208: Gatevale turnstile counters at the Merrow Field pilot double-count when a rotation reverses mid-cycle. Attendance totals drift roughly 2% high per event. The debounce window fix is implemented, reviewed by Ilsa, and soak-tested across two simulated match days without drift. Ready for your cut; the candidate build is identified below.

trace token, tagag-tafog: htk6_5ed18c

## Deployment

Crumbline's order-cutoff service enforces the rule that bakery orders placed after the daily cutoff roll to the next production day. Deploys go through the Ovenrail pipeline; the release manager tags a version and the pipeline handles blue-green swapping. Cutoff times are timezone-aware and read at startup, so a restart is required after any change. Rollbacks simply re-tag the prior version. The service starts with the configuration values below.

deployment values, bagap-kagaf:
[wenmir]
port = 5432
team = frair
host = wenmir.zarqelnet.test
region = east-4
access_code = ac_b2428f
timeout_ms = 500